Design of a frame synchronization circuit based on FPGA

Abstract
The principle of a frame synchronization in digital communiction based on FPGA is described.Then using MAX+PLUSII,digital communication frame synchronization circuit is designed through VHDL language and graphic editor.The design of key part is elaborated,Top file and correlative simulation figure are presented,The circuit is integreted in chip of FPGA.It is the base of digitization and integration in communication(system.)
